  118: my $gnuplot_help_text = <<"ENDPLOTHELP";
  119: <p>
  120: The <b>gnuplot</b> tag allows an author to design a plot which can
  121: be created on the fly.  This is intended for use in homework problems
  122: where each student needs to see a distinct plot.  It can be used in
  123: conjunction with a <b>script</b> tag to generate random plots.
  124: </p><p>
  125: A <b>gnuplot</b> tag can contain the following sub-tags:
  126: </p>
  127: <dl>
  128: <dt> Plot Label
  129:     <dd> Allows you to place text at a given (x,y) coordinate on the plot.
  130: <dt> Plot Title
  131:     <dd> The title of the plot
  132: <dt> Plot Xlabel
  133:     <dd> The label on the horizontal axis of the plot
  134: <dt> Plot Ylabel
  135:     <dd> The label on the vertical axis of the plot
  136: <dt> Plot Axes
  137:     <dd> allows specification of the x and y ranges displayed in the plot
  138: <dt> Plot Key
  139:     <dd> Lists the functions displayed in the plot.
  140: <dt> Plot Curve
  141:     <dd> Sets the data used in the plot.
  142: <dt> Plot Tics
  143:     <dd> Allows specification of the x and y coordinate 'tics' on the axes.
  144: This is mostly used to adjust the grid lines when a grid is displayed.
  145: </dl>
  146: If you are having trouble with your plot, please read the help
  147: available on Plot Curve.
  148: ENDPLOTHELP

  371: my $curve_help_text = <<"ENDCURVEHELP";
  372: The <b>curve</b> tag is where you set the data to be plotted by gnuplot.
  373: There are two ways of entering the information:
  374: <dl>
  375:     <dt> Curve Data
  376:     <dd> Using a <b>data</b> tag you can specify the numbers used to produce 
  377: the plot.  
  378: <p>
  379: By default, two <b>data</b> tags will be available in a plot.  The
  380: first will specify X coordinates of the data and the second will
  381: give the Y coordinates of the data.  When working with a linestyle that 
  382: requires more than two data sets, inserting another <b>data</b> tag is
  383: required.  Unfortunately, you must make sure the <b>data</b> tags appear
  384: in the order gnuplot expects the data.
  385: </p><p>
  386: Specifying the data should usually be done with a perl variable or array, 
  387: such as \@Xdata and \@Ydata.  You may also specify numerical data seperated 
  388: by commas.  Again, the order of the <b>data</b> tags is important.  The
  389: first tag will be the X data and the second will be the Y data.
  390: </p>
  391:     <dt> Curve Function
  392:     <dd> The <b>function</b> tag allows you to specify the curve to be 
  393: plotted as a formula that gnuplot can understand.  <b>Be careful using this
  394: tag.</b>  It is surprisingly easy to give gnuplot a function it cannot deal
  395: with properly.  Be explicit: 2*sin(2*3.141592*x/4) will work but
  396: 2sin(2*3.141592x/4) will not.  If you do not receive any errors in the
  397: gnuplot data but still do not have an image produced, it is likely there
  398: is an error in your <b>function</b> tag.
  399: </dl>
  400: ENDCURVEHELP
